Step 5: Pick the Right Pound

Not every “pound” is the same unit. Match the pound to the situation:

  • Avoirdupois pound (453.59237 g) — food, kitchen scales, postage, body weight, retail, sports equipment. When a label or recipe says “lb” without qualification, this is the unit. 791 g = 1.7439 lb.
  • Troy pound (373.2417216 g) — historical unit for precious metals (12 troy ounces). 791 g = 2.1193 lb t. The troy pound is lighter than the avoirdupois pound, which surprises most people.
  • Metric pound (500 g) — informal European usage at markets in Germany (“Pfund”) and other countries. 791 g = 1.582 metric pounds.

Grams & Pounds — A Quick Primer

The Gram (g) — Metric Mass

A gram is the metric system’s everyday unit of mass, defined as one-thousandth of a kilogram (the SI base unit). It was originally tied to the mass of one cubic centimetre of water at 4 °C. Since the 2019 SI redefinition, the kilogram — and therefore the gram — is defined through Planck’s constant, making it independent of any physical artifact. Grams are the standard unit on kitchen scales outside the United States and on every pharmaceutical or scientific scale worldwide. A value of 791 grams is commonly encountered in groceries, books and small appliances.

The Pound (lb) — More Than One Definition

“Pound” is one of the most ambiguous words in measurement, because at least four distinct pounds have been used historically. Three of them are still encountered today, and each one gives a different answer for 791 grams:

Avoirdupois pound (lb)

= 453.59237 g (exact). The default pound for food, postage, body weight and consumer goods. When a label or recipe says “lb” without qualification, this is the unit. 791 g = 1.7439 lb.

Troy pound (lb t)

= 373.2417216 g (12 troy ounces). Historically used for precious metals and coinage. Lighter than the avoirdupois pound. 791 g = 2.1193 lb t.

Metric pound (Pfund)

= 500 g exactly. Common at European markets, especially in Germany. 791 g = 1.582 metric pounds.

Apothecaries’ pound

= 373.2417216 g. Historical pharmacy unit, equal to the troy pound. Now obsolete in modern medicine.

Why the Conversion Is Exact

Unlike grams-to-cups or grams-to-tablespoons (where the answer depends on the ingredient’s density), grams-to-pounds is a fixed mass-to-mass conversion. The 1959 International Yard and Pound Agreement defined the avoirdupois pound as exactly 0.45359237 kg — a deliberate, rational number chosen by treaty. Sixteen ounces fit in a pound, so one ounce is exactly 28.349523125 grams. That makes the conversion of 791 grams to pounds mathematically exact to the limits of arithmetic, not an approximation. Every NIST, BIPM, ISO and consumer-protection authority worldwide uses the same factor.

A Brief History of the Pound

The pound traces its name to the Roman libra pondo (literally “a pound by weight”) — which is also why we still abbreviate it “lb.” For centuries, Britain, France, Spain and the German states each used their own incompatible pound. The Tower pound (350 g), the merchant’s pound (467 g), the London pound (467 g), and dozens of regional variants were all in everyday use. The avoirdupois pound emerged in late-medieval English wool trading and was standardized through Acts of Parliament before the metric system existed. In 1959 the United States, United Kingdom, Canada, Australia, New Zealand and South Africa agreed on the single modern definition still used today.
